Opportunities: Build a lasting career with us, supported by ongoing opportunities for growth and progression.</li> </ul> <h2><b>What You’ll Do</b></h2> <ul> <li>Write clean, well‑organized, and sustainable .
NET code that powers our next‑generation solutions.</li> <li>Design and enhance software, from creating new features to maintaining and improving existing applications.</li> <li>Contribute ideas that drive software innovation and elevate our products.</li> <li>Champion best practices in software development within a collaborative environment.</li> <li>Troubleshoot and debug deployed software to ensure reliability and performance.</li> <li>Document technical requirements clearly for seamless teamwork.</li> <li>Collaborate closely with developers, product managers, testers, and operations staff—learning from a wealth of experienced, long‑serving colleagues.</li> </ul> <h2><b>What We’re Looking For</b></h2> <ul> <li>Expert knowledge of C# and the .
NET Framework.</li> <li>Experience with relational databases (Microsoft SQL, Postgre SQL).</li> <li>Background in ASP.
NETMVC / Web API.</li> <li>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or a related field.</li> <li>Hands‑on experience with event‑driven programming and message brokers (Rabbit MQ, Kafka, etc.).</li> <li>2+ years of relevant professional experience.</li> <li>Strong communication and interpersonal skills.</li> <li>Familiarity with multi‑threaded or concurrent programming.</li> </ul> <h2><b>Bonus Points For</b></h2> <ul> <li>Experience with CI/CD pipelines and tools.</li> <li>Familiarity with non‑relational databases, especially Cassandra.</li> <li>Exposure to real‑time data acquisition and industrial protocols (OPC UA, MODBUS, Sparkplug B).</li> <li>Web development skills in HTML5, Java Script, Angular, Node. js, or Type Script are a plus.</li> </ul> <p>At Petrolink, you’ll find more than just a job—you’ll discover real opportunities for advancement and ongoing learning.
